Player Profile[]

Scott Parker is a goalkeeper at Premiership club Hardly Athletic. Will be retiring from international football at end of season, he continues his duty for his country as England U21 Manager after stepping up from 3 seasons as England U18.

Scott started hes career at Hedben Blues Under the guidance of former SM Gary Smith, but once Gary left the game Parker decided to reset and become one of Englands best keepers, hes Career got off to a shakey start from was a season at Ørn Christiania then Parker took a huge gamble on returning to England with Abel Academy but within a few weeks of Joining Abel went AWOL and Parker was left to rot in a managerless team awaiting hes FS fan to run out or 30 day contract Termination to auto accept, at this point he gave up and took a break, 3 months later after logging in for first time in ages was contacted by then England u18 manager Norman Goldsmith, who see the protentual in Parker to become one of Enlgnads great keepers, This is when Parker spent most of hes career with Getozachoppa FC, under the guidance of Norman Parker grew and grew NT caps came flying in and on 12/11/2011 something great happened
